If f (x) = 12x^2-5 and g (x) = x+7 find (f•g) (x)

    12x^3 + 84x^2 - 5x - 35

    Step-by-step explanation:

    multiply both of the polynomials together

    12x^2 - 5 * x + 7

    First, multiply x with everything

    12x^2 - 5 * x = 12x^3 - 5x

    then, multiply 7 by everything

    12x^2 - 5 * 7 = 84 ^2 - 35

    Last, add both of them together

    12x^3 - 5x + 84x^2 - 35 = 12x^3 + 84x^2 - 5x - 35

    12x^3 + 84x^2 - 5x - 35
